15082077 Fiorini C, Tilloy-Ellul A, Chevalier S, Charuel C, Pointis G: Sertoli cell junctional proteins as early targets for different classes of reproductive toxicants. Reprod Toxicol. 2004 May;18(3):413-21.

Western blot and immunofluorescence analyses showed that SerW3 Sertoli cells expressed typical components of tight (occludin and zonula occludens-1), anchoring (N-cadherin) and gap (connexin 43) junctions.
Testicular toxicants (DDT, pentachlorophenol, dieldrin, dinitrobenzene, cadmium chloride, cisplatin, gossypol, bisphenol A and tert-octylphenol) affected intercellular junctions by either reducing the amount or inducing aberrant intracellular localization of these membranous proteins.

18040759 Sidorova TS, Matesic DF: Protective effect of the natural product, chaetoglobosin K, on lindane- and dieldrin-induced changes in astroglia: identification of activated signaling pathways. Pharm Res. 2008 Jun;25(6):1297-308.

CONCLUSION: ChK's protective effects, both preventative and reversal, on lindane and dieldrin inhibition of gap junction-mediated communication are associated with stabilization and reappearance of the connexin 43 P2 phosphoform and may be mediated by the Akt pathway.

8068183 Matesic DF, Rupp HL, Bonney WJ, Ruch RJ, Trosko JE: Changes in gap-junction permeability, phosphorylation, and number mediated by phorbol ester and non-phorbol-ester tumor promoters in rat liver epithelial cells. Mol Carcinog. 1994 Aug;10(4):226-36.

The effects of three tumor promoters on gap-junction permeability; connexin 43 and 26 mRNA levels, protein levels, and phosphorylation; and the numbers of gap-junctional membrane plaques were studied in the rat liver epithelial cell line WB-F344 to determine whether changes in these parameters correlated with the inhibition of gap-junction function. 12-O-tetradecanoylphorbol-13-acetate (TPA; 10 ng/mL), dieldrin (10 micrograms/mL), and heptachlor epoxide (10 micrograms/mL) inhibited gap-junctional intercellular communication (GJIC) assayed by fluorescent dye transfer by 80-90% after a 5-min exposure and by more than 90% within 1 h.

8820588 Kang KS, Wilson MR, Hayashi T, Chang CC, Trosko JE: Inhibition of gap junctional intercellular communication in normal human breast epithelial cells after treatment with pesticides, PCBs, and PBBs, alone or in mixtures. Environ Health Perspect. 1996 Feb;104(2):192-200.

The scrape-loading/dye transfer and fluorescent redistribution after photobleaching techniques were used to measure GJIC; immunostaining and Western and Northern analyses were performed on connexin 43 (Cx43) gap junction protein and message to determine how halogenated hydrocarbons might affect GJIC.
DDT, dieldrin, and toxaphene inhibited GJIC in a dose-responsive manner after 90 min treatments.

11787861 Matesic DF, Blommel ML, Sunman JA, Cutler SJ, Cutler HG: Prevention of organochlorine-induced inhibition of gap junctional communication by chaetoglobosin K in astrocytes. Cell Biol Toxicol. 2001;17(6):395-408.

In this study, the organochlorine xenobiotics dieldrin and endosulfan, at micromolar concentrations, were found to inhibit gap junction-mediated intercellular communication and induce hypophosphorylation of connexin 43 in cultured rat astrocytes, the predominant cell type in the brain coupled through gap junctions.
